Evaluation of hybrid resultedrom crossing ofMadura and oriental tobaccoProductivity and quality of tobacco could be improved by improving genetical traits through crossing Oiental tobacco was used as donor parent due to high number of leaves and aromatic that was able to enhanced the yield and quality of Madura tobacco. The exploits of heterosis in hybrid were expected to short cut the time of research The experiment was conducted in some villages i.e. [«bbek and Klompang Barat (District of Pamekasan). Por-dapor and Guluk-guluk (District of Sumenep) during 1997 season. The treatments consisted of four hybrids and Prancak-95 as the standard variety Hie purpose of the experiment was to find out the potency of hybrids and their improvement compared to Prancak-95. Sliced tobacco yields of all treatments were not different, except Ft Prancak-95x Ismir produced 0.701 Mia. closed to Prancak-95, i.e. 0.703 Mia Genotype x environment interaction affected on grade index, but this hybrid still the best one in Lebbek. K lompang Barat. and Por-dapor. Its standard heterosis was 43% while standard heterosis for crop index was 31.41%.

The stability of yield and quality of the new lines of Temanggung tobaccoThe productivity of Temanggung tobacco is relatively low. One of the causes of the low productivity is genetic deterioration. Fom a series of selection, four lines were potential to be developed. Befoe the new varieties are released they need to be tested at different locations in a central poducing area. The tests were conducted at 1 1 locations in Temanggung District rom 1995 to 1997. The lines tested included four selected lines, original population of Temanggung tobacco.from which the selected lines were produced, and Kemloko, a local variety generally planted by farmers. The trial, were designed as a randomized block in three replicates for respective location. Results showed that two of four tested lines i.e. 2258/2/1/1 and 2132/2/2/1/1 produced stable yield and quality. Compared with Kemloko (local variety) the dry sliced tobacco, grade index and crop index of 2258/2/1/1 increased by 17.57, 6.85, and 26.88% respectively and those of 2132/2/2/1/1 increased by 12.28, 16.03, and 31.88% respectively.

Resistance in Temanggung tobacco lines to tobacco aphid (Myzus persicae Sulzer)The evaluation on the esistance of Temanggung obacco lines against tobacco aphid was carried out in Malang, from August 19% to March 1997. The experiments consisted of antixenosis and antibiosis resistance. The teatments wee four tobacco lines fom the original population: (1) S.2258, (2) S.2132, (3) S.l%3, (4) S.1965; four lines rom selected population: (5) S.2258/2/1/1, (6) S.2132/2/2/1/1, (7) S.1%3/3/2/1/2/1, (8) S.1%5/2/1/2/1/1; one local line: (9) Kemloko (Gober genjah); two varieties resistant and susceptible o tobacco aphid: (10) Coker 176, and (11) NC95. The treatments wee arranged in randomized block design, with three replications. The esults showed that the two lines from the selection evaluation: S.2258/2/1/1 and S.1%3/3/2/1/2/1 wee resistant to tobacco aphid. Both lines had high density of leaf trichomes, and can be used as resistant resources in plant breeding activities.

This expeiment was caried out at Palalang Village, Sub Pakong Distict, Pamekasan District, rom April to October 2000. There were 137 treatments, consisted of 100 FS lines [number 1 to 50 were progeny of Prancak-95 x IW (oriental), number 51 to 100 were progeny of Prancak-95 x IS (oiental)], 36 lines were selected from local cultivar, and Prancak-95 as a check variety. This experiment was arranged in randomized block design, two replications. The objective of this research was to select the promising lines based on crop index and nicotine content. Each lines were morphologically homogen, the potency of yield and quality among lines were significantly different. Foty-four lines were selected. They were resemble to Prancak-95, their nicotine content varied from 1.84% to 4.09%. Genotype and phenotype correlation between nicotine content and yield and grade index were not significantly different. There were 11 selected lines out of the 44 with crop index higher than that of Prancak-95, and their nicotine content vaied from 1.90 -3.96%.

Four hybrids resulted from the first generation of the crossing of madura and oiental tobaccos and Prancak-95 aa a standard vaiety were tested at several locations from 1997 to 2000 randomized block design. The experiments aimed at obtaining promising hybid varieties of the madura tobacco. The yield potency, quality and stability of the hybrids were tested by using the method of yau and HAMBLIN (1994), which was based on lite highest average and the loweat standard deviation. Two promising hybrids, i.e. PIS and PXA had quality and crop indexes higher and had lower content of nicotine compared to that of Prancak 95, and they were more adaptive compared with Prancak-95. The quality indexes of PIS, PXA and Prancak-95 were respectively 79.30 ; 75.65 and 65.02.
